Sol–gel niobia sorbent with a positively charged octadecyl ligand providing enhanced enrichment of nucleotides and organophosphorus pesticides in capillary microextraction for online HPLC analysis

Abstract: A niobia-based sol-gel organic-inorganic hybrid sorbent carrying a positively charged C ligand (Nb O -C (+ve)) was synthesized to achieve enhanced enrichment capability in capillary microextraction of organophosphorus compounds (which include organophosphorus pesticides and nucleotides) before their online analysis by high-performance liquid chromatography. The sorbent was designed to simultaneously provide three different types of molecular level interactions: electrostatic, Lewis acid-base, and van der Waals… Show more

“…This is because the sol–gel chemistry involves the chemical bonding of the polymer coating inside the fused silica capillary. Utilization of sol–gel chemistry has helped to introduce different types of functional groups into the growing sol–gel network that resultantly form a polymeric coating to the inner surface of fused silica capillary and enhances the extraction and sensitivity. Right after the introduction of sol–gel chemistry for CME, many silica‐based and without silica‐based polymeric coatings were introduced for improved characteristics and better extraction.…”
